What is Smart Warehousing?
Smart Warehousing operates as a premier provider of comprehensive warehousing, fulfillment, and logistical solutions. Strategically headquartered in Kansas City, the company serves as a critical node in the American supply chain, offering high-velocity distribution services that cater to complex enterprise requirements. By integrating advanced inventory management systems with a robust physical footprint, the firm enables businesses to streamline their operations and reduce lead times significantly.

How much funding has Smart Warehousing raised?
Smart Warehousing has raised a total of $2M across 1 funding round:
Debt
$2M
Debt (2020): $2M with participation from PPP
